Synergistic Research Alpha Sterling:


The Synergistic Alpha Sterling really clicked with my system. Its character was richly midrange, sweet and smooth, detailed where necessary but never forced or strident in the lower treble. Its greatest was its balance and transparency: It was open across the spectrum, with excellent imaging and instrumental layering. Background vocals and soft acoustic instrumentation emerged with new details and body. While it scaled the soundstage down in comparison to the Kimber Hero, it also suggested a neutrality and smoothness in the treble that I missed with the Kimber. String sections on Mahler's Sixth rarely hinted at edginess. While the Hero was a leader in bass extension and focus, the Alpha was tops in the upper midrange and well into the treble. It performed effortlessly, suggesting music reproduction with hardly and artificiality - no peakiness, sweet details with etching. While it challenged my high-priced reference, the Nordost Valhalla, in virtually all sonic criteria, the Synergistic ultimately couldn't achieve the robust harmonic liveliness or effortless extension that makes the Valhalla seem not of this world. The comparison provided a glimpse of how narrow the performance gap is and how quickly it's closing. No cable in this survey ranked higher overall than the Synergistic, for me.

Neil Gader's Associated Components

Sota Cosmos Series III turntable; SME V arm; Shure V15xMR cartridge; Sony C222ES SACD Multi-Channel, Sony DVP-9000ES; Plinius 8200 integrated amp; Placette Volume Control preamp; Rotel RMB-1075 amp; ATC SCM 20SL, Infinity Intermezzo 2.6, Snell K.5 speakers; Nordost Valhalla & Blue Heaven cabling; Kimber Kable BiFocal XL, Wireworld Equinox III, CPCC, Wireworld Silver Electra power cords; Poly Crystal rack; AudioPrism Quiet Lines, Sanus Systems equipment stands
